It's been about 2500 miles since my last oil change (filled up with 4 quarts after oil and filter change) and when i checked my oil sight glass today before starting her up, I couldnt see any oil. Ended up adding about 3/4 quart of oil to bring the level back up. There is no visible leaks and the bike doesnt seem to burn oil, and no sign of oil in the airfilter. Im just wondering if anyone else has this happen to them or is there something wrong with my busa?

look at your mufflers and see if you have soot build up on the outlets.  My Busa would use oil depending on how I was riding.  Every now and then it would smoke really badly but some times it would show any smoke at all.  I later found out that it had a few bad valve guide seals.
